Why Did George Lucas Sell Star Wars? The Surprising Reason

George Lucas sold Star Wars to Disney in 2012, marking one of the most significant shifts in entertainment ownership and creative direction for the franchise. This move reshaped how the saga would be expanded, adapted, and presented to new generations of fans.

Understanding the reasons behind this high-profile sale requires looking at Lucas’s long-term vision, Disney’s strategic goals, and the evolving landscape of film and streaming.

Aspect Details Impact
Seller George Lucas Original creator and controlling owner
Buyer The Walt Disney Company Major media and streaming conglomerate
Deal Value Approximately $4.05 billion One of the largest media acquisitions of the era
Year 2012 Announced and closed within the same year
Key Assets Included Feature films, characters, TV series rights, Skywalker Sound Comprehensive ownership of the franchise

The Creative Vision Behind the Sale

Lucas’s Long-Term Goals

George Lucas always framed Star Wars as a story that belonged to a larger mythic tradition, yet he retained tight control over its future during most of his leadership. By the 2010s, he had publicly stated a desire to step away from daily operations and focus on personal projects, including documentaries and experimental cinema.

Selling the franchise offered Lucas a way to transition into retirement while preserving his legacy through a company with global distribution and marketing reach.

Disney’s Strategic Acquisition

Strengthening Entertainment Portfolio

Disney pursued the acquisition to expand beyond its traditional theme parks and animated offerings, securing a treasured franchise with built-in brand loyalty and cross-generational appeal. The purchase aligned with Disney’s broader goal of owning flagship properties that drive parks, merchandise, and streaming content.

With Lucas unwilling to commit to ongoing sequel and television development, Disney’s bid presented an opportunity to stabilize long-term plans for the Star Wars universe.

Financial and Business Drivers

Market Valuation and Growth Potential

The $4.05 billion price tag reflected the immense commercial value of Star Wars, encompassing films, merchandise, television rights, and licensing. For Lucas, this represented not only a financial windfall but also a clean break from the responsibilities of running a major entertainment asset.

Disney, in turn, viewed the acquisition as a strategic investment with significant upside in theatrical releases, home entertainment, fast-food partnerships, and emerging streaming markets.

Legacy and Franchise Management

Continuity Through Corporate Ownership

Under Disney, Star Wars has seen a mix of theatrical sequels, standalone films, and streaming series that would have been difficult to coordinate under Lucas’s more hands-on model. The company established dedicated divisions, such as Lucasfilm Ltd., to maintain creative continuity while expanding into new formats.

This shift enabled more ambitious marketing campaigns, synchronized release strategies, and deeper audience engagement across multiple platforms.
